Customer Care … CRM … Customer Experience — What’s the Difference?

ClearAction

Customer Profitability (efforts to increase revenue and profit from customers). Customer relationship management (CRM) — use of a database of customer transactions and facts that enable customized communications (1-to-1 marketing), upselling, cross-selling, and data-mining.

What are the Other Names for Customer Success Manager?

SmartKarrot

There are various other names for customer success manager being used in the industry like Customer Success Engineer, Sales Manager, Customer Success Specialist, others. We notice there is decent overlap with account management, sales and customer support. McKinsey names this as the first version.
